Gatka - Sikh Martial arts

Having watched almost every Jackie Chan movie in childhood, its no wonder that fascination with action movies still continues. After all these years of watching these movies, the question lingers in mind is that do we not have Indian forms/techniques of martial arts that are equally lethal and awe-inspiring as Kung-Fu or Karate? Well, thankfully the answer is YES! (You aren't first one to be surprised!) Our school curriculum that has trite explanation about our country's diversity should have taught us about these various fighting techniques/art that has been preserved over centuries in many parts of our country. As a matter of fact researched material suggests Chinese martial arts is in all likelyhood derivation of these old Bharatiya (carefully avoiding saying Indian) traditions. These traditions include art of fighting using lethal weapons such as swords and bows, hand to hand combat and self-defence with wooden sticks. If you truly have passion for combat techniques,self-defence methods or simply interest in exploring more, by now you are curious to read the names of these Bharatiya martial arts techniques. "Thang-Ta", "Gatka", and "kalarippayattu" are some of the methods among many and more popularly practised even today. These methods come from the states of Manipur, Punjab and Kerala respectively. Quick take aways from latest information released by Urban Development Ministry on the state of our cities on Sanitation Parameters.
1)Cities ranked in four categories - green, blue, black and red with green being the best.
2)No city could qualify in the green category.
3)Only four cities are in blue category.
4)3 Gujarat cities land in top 20 position.
5)Top 3 are Chandigadh,Mysore and Surat (YAY!!!).
6)As many as 189 out of rated 423 big/small towns ended up in Red zone !! (check you city in the list)
7)About dozen cities have potential to move one step up from BLACK level to BLUE level with more efforts and programs dedicated to sanitization.
8)About 60 cities have potential to move from RED zone to BLACK zone with similar efforts.
9)Minister, Shri Jaipal Reddy congratulated the only four cities in blue category and expressed hopes that they would turn GREEN in future.

Gujarat police to procure 4000 INSAS rifles
In a bid to equip its police force with modern weapons, Gujarat police would be acquiring 4000 Indian Small Arms System (INSAS)rifles in October this year. "We procured 2,000 INSAS rifles in 2008-09 and will be getting 4,000 more in coming October. INSAS rifles are mostly used by BSF, CRPF and para military forces," a state home department official said. He also said that the state's pending demand for 12 more marine police stations is likely to be approved by the Union Ministry of Home Affairs. Currently, there are 10 marine police stations in the state, along the 1600-km-long coast line.
On various plans to strengthen the state's security apparatus, the official said that in last two years, around 5,000 posts in the police force have been created with the addition of State Reserved Police (SRP) battalions. "We created around 5,000 new posts in the force. Moreover, we will add four more chetak commando units next year," he said. "Currently, we have two Chetak commando units, which is based on NSG model and two more will be added this year while we plan to double it by next year, and then the commando units will be spread across the state and stationed in Saurashtra, Kutch and South Gujarat," he said.
Each chetak commando unit has 120 commandos which are trained extensively. "One commando unit is under training at Jodhpur and subsequently, that unit will be sent for advanced training in jungle warfare," the official said, adding "we strictly follow the age and physical fitness standards in the commando units."
